I tasted one very fine value-priced sparkler Saturday at Arrow Wine’s Centerville store: The Ca’ Tullio Prosecco ($13.99). Plenty of intensity, with good fruit flavors but a dry finish. By gosh, maybe there is something to all this Prosecco hype.
And on the same day, the Dorothy Lane Market Oakwood store was pouring a crowd-pleasing, delicious, semi-sweet La Spinetta Moscato d’Asti ($18). This is a consistently fine bottling from a dependable producer, and boasts a peachy, lychee-fruit flavors balanced by enough bright acidity to keep it from being cloying. One other plus, if you’re going to serve this wine over the holidays to folks who don’t usually imbibe, is its alcohol level: a modest 5.5 percent.
